Liberia partnershipAt Troy first, we are grateful for our partnership in Monrovia, Liberia. We support our partner church Monrovia First, the Judith Craig Orphanage by helping provide food and proper facilities, and the Siyfa Keh-Town School by stocking their library shelves. This connection reminds us of our calling to serve our God-given neighbors both near and far, sharing the love of Christ across the world.

Woodward Outreach
|
Woodward Outreach is a mission that provides services for the hungry and the homeless along Woodward Avenue in Ferndale. It is a partnership between Ferndale First UMC and Troy First UMC.
Every Monday and Friday, Ferndale First opens their doors to anyone and everyone to provide free hot meals, a sandwich to-go, access to their Community Clothing Closet, private showers, laundry facilities, and free adult incontinence supplies.
